SAFETY, MERGED AWAY. Johannes Heidecke, Head of Safety Systems at OpenAI, told his team on Friday he is leaving. His last day is July 24. The Safety Systems team he ran is being folded into Research.
Mia Glaese, previously VP Research and Head of Alignment, is now VP Research and Safety. Saachi Jain steps in as interim Head of Safety Systems, reporting to Glaese. Chief Research Officer Mark Chen wrote an internal memo. He said it is "important that our safety work is integrated with frontier-model development, with an earlier and more direct role in shaping key model, product and launch decisions."
Heidecke joined OpenAI in 2021 as a safety analyst. He took over Safety Systems in 2024 after Lilian Weng left to co-found Thinking Machines. Neither Heidecke nor OpenAI stated a reason for his exit. His next job is not disclosed.

Five other OpenAI exits precede this one.
OpenAI fired Ryan Beiermeister, VP Product Policy, in early January. The company cited sexual discrimination. She denies it. She had opposed the ChatGPT adult-mode rollout and flagged weak child-exploitation safeguards.
Andrea Vallone, Head of Model Policy and OpenAI's mental-health safety lead, left in January. She joined Anthropic alignment.
Doctor Zoë Hitzig, a research scientist on safety policy, resigned February 11. She published a New York Times guest essay titled "OpenAI Is Making the Mistakes Facebook Made. I Quit." She objected to ChatGPT ads.
The same day, OpenAI dissolved its Mission Alignment team. Joshua Achiam had led it since September 2024. OpenAI reassigned the team's six or seven members. The company called it "routine reorganizations that occur within a fast-moving company."
Fidji Simo, CEO of Applications and OpenAI's number two, stepped down July 9. She cited a relapse of POTS, a chronic neuroimmune condition.
OpenAI promoted Achiam to Chief Futurist after Mission Alignment dissolved. He told colleagues July 1 he is leaving at the end of July. No stated reason. Next destination not disclosed.

Anthropic has its own exit. Doctor Mrinank Sharma, Head of Safeguards Research, resigned February 9. His public letter said "the world is in peril." It said "we constantly face pressures to set aside what matters most." He said he might pursue a poetry degree. He named no specific product.
Talent flows one direction. Vallone crossed from OpenAI to Anthropic in January. Doctor John Jumper, Nobel laureate for protein folding, worked at Google DeepMind. Bloomberg reported June 19 he is moving to Anthropic.

THE COMPLIANCE-WHEN-FORCED PATTERN. Character Technologies settled five federal teen-harm suits in January. Italy's Garante fined the same company one hundred fifty-eight thousand euros on July 9. Meta pulled Muse Image after four days.
Judge Anne C. Conway terminated Garcia v. Character Technologies on January 7, 2026. Four sister cases closed the same week. A.F. in Eastern Texas. Montoya and E.S. in Colorado. P.J. in the Northern District of New York.
Judge Conway's May 2025 ruling stands. She denied motions to dismiss Google LLC and Alphabet Inc. She denied them for co-founders Noam Shazeer and Daniel De Freitas Adiwarsana. She rejected the argument that chatbot output is protected speech. Plaintiffs in later OpenAI and Replika suits now cite her.
The parties sealed the terms.
. . .
Six months later, Italy's data protection authority hit Character Technologies again. The Garante fined the company one hundred fifty-eight thousand euros on July 9, 2026. Grounds: inadequate user information, weak minor safeguards, ineffective age verification, a late Data Protection Impact Assessment, no EU representative.
The Garante ordered further minor protections beyond those already in place. It is the first Western regulator fine squarely targeting a companion chatbot on minor-safety grounds.
Character Technologies did not audit its age gate before the fine. The Florida wrongful-death docket did not force the audit. A European privacy regulator did.
. . .
The next day, Meta killed Muse Image. Instagram users had been generating AI images from other people's public photos for four days. Then SAG-AFTRA and Hollywood talent agencies objected. Meta pulled the feature.
Meta's stated reason: the feature "misses the mark" on users' privacy.
Eli Tan reported it in The New York Times on July 10. BBC, Reuters, Guardian, and The Verge corroborated.
The privacy problem existed on day one. Meta shipped anyway. The retraction came four days later, after agencies with lawyers pushed back.

THE REGULATOR THAT PULLED THE PLUG. Beijing pulled the plug on July 15. Washington and Brussels wrote memos.
ByteDance told its Doubao users the humanlike agent feature goes offline today. Alibaba told its Qwen users the same. Both companies cited "product function adjustments." Neither pretended it was voluntary.
New rules from Chinese regulators took effect the same morning. The target is narrow. Services that mimic human personality and provide emotional support. The named harms are narrower still: emotional dependence and content unsuitable for minors.
This is the first time a major market has ordered consumer companion chatbot features switched off by regulation. Not fined. Not labeled. Switched off.
. . .
The same week, Western regulators moved differently.
On July 1, the Federal Trade Commission opened docket FTC-2026-0859. The Commission posted a proposed policy statement on AI accuracy. Public comment runs through July 31. The docket seeks views. It orders nothing.
On July 8, the European Commission adopted an Opinion on the voluntary Code of Practice. It covers AI Act Articles 50(2), (4), and (5). The Commission endorsed the disclosure regime. The Code labels AI-generated content. It does not switch anything off.
On July 9, Italy's Garante fined Character Technologies one hundred fifty-eight thousand euros. The finding cited weak age verification. The Garante did not order Character.AI offline. The product still runs in Italy.

THE SCOREBOARD NOBODY FILLS IN. A new benchmark measures what psychiatric competence looks like inside a large language model. The strongest model tested trailed human clinicians by 37.28 points. No consumer chatbot vendor has published its score.
The paper landed on arXiv on July 9, 2026. It calls itself MentalHospital. It is a virtual environment built around the S.O.A.P. workflow that every psychiatric resident learns. Subjective, Objective, Assessment, Plan.
The authors seeded it with one thousand one hundred and ninety-three de-identified psychiatric records. The records span all major ICD-11 categories and seventy-six discrete disorders. Skill-augmented standardized clients play the standardized cases. A dual-track protocol scores the model against the actual chart and against the process a clinician would follow.
. . .
Five domain evaluators, together called MentalEval, agree with human experts at an average quadratic weighted kappa of 0.944. Twenty-two practicing clinicians rated the simulation's fidelity at 3.88 out of 5. The measurement instrument holds up.
The result is blunt. The best model trailed clinicians by 37.28 points on objective psychiatric competence. The bottleneck was mental status assessment. That is the eye-to-eye work. A clinician deciding whether the chart matches the person in the room.
. . .
Nobody had to invent a new instrument. VERA-MH has been public since February 11, 2026. Bentley and colleagues at Spring Health published the code, the rubric, and the personas on GitHub. Any vendor with an engineering team could run it in an afternoon.
Last week's CAW reporting counted them. Zero. Not one of the six major LLM vendors has published a VERA-MH score for a consumer chatbot. The scoreboard is filled in by clinicians and academics.
. . .
On July 8, the European Commission adopted an Opinion. It endorses the voluntary Code of Practice on Transparency of AI-generated content. The AI Board signed off the next day. The underlying rules under AI Act Article 50 take effect on August 2, 2026.
Read the Code carefully. Labels for deepfakes and AI-generated public-interest text. A notice that the user is talking to a chatbot. And nothing requiring any vendor to publish a capability score.

SELLING TO THE BLACKLIST. Two safety guardrails failed on the same day. OpenAI and Google routed frontier AI to blacklisted Chinese firms through Singapore. Boko Haram used chatbots to build bombs.
The Financial Times reported on July 10 that OpenAI and Google supplied AI services to Singapore-based subsidiaries of Alibaba, Baidu, and Tencent. The parent companies sit on United States government blacklists. The blacklists restrict frontier AI sales to them.
The subsidiaries are the workaround.
Route the contract through Singapore. The parent gets the model. The export control gets nothing.
The Financial Times frames this as an enforcement question. The frame is generous. Enforcement assumes someone tried.
. . .
The New York Times ran the second story the same day. Reporters Dustin Volz and Eric Schmitt published new research on how violent extremists are using conversational AI. The old frame was propaganda. Recruitment videos. Slick messaging.
The new frame is operations.
Boko Haram in Nigeria is using chatbots to aid bomb construction and attack planning. Not to inspire fighters. To arm them.
The misuse-monitoring stacks the industry pointed to for two years did not catch it. Researchers did.

SOMEONE IS DOING IT RIGHT. A team at Yale built an AI that catches life-threatening diagnoses everyone else's AI misses. In blinded emergency-room testing, it caught seventy-eight percent of the true emergencies. GPT-5 caught fifty-two.
Picture the difference. A woman walks into a Yale emergency room at three in the morning with a bad headache. GPT-5 tells the resident it looks like a migraine. The Yale system, called AegisDx, says migraine is possible. Then it lists what you cannot miss. Meningitis. A bleed in the brain. A tear in the artery going to the head. Run the tests.
Twenty-six people out of every hundred, in that ER, in that test, would have gone home with the wrong story. AegisDx sent them for the scan instead.
. . .
Yale tested AegisDx against GPT-5 on forty-three real emergency-room cases. Physicians read the answers blind. A composite safety score went from four-point-three-one to four-point-five-five out of five. That looks small. It is not. The odds the gap is random come out to less than one in four thousand.
The New England Journal of Medicine publishes hard cases. AegisDx got the right diagnosis in its top three sixty-three percent of the time. GPT-5 got there fifty-one. The Journal of the American Medical Association's toughest cases: sixty against fifty-two. The pattern held across every benchmark.
. . .
The trick is not a bigger model. It is a smaller step the model has to take before it answers.
Before AegisDx says anything, it stops and asks itself one question. What would kill this person if I got this wrong? It runs the answer through a short screening list. Then it speaks.
That step is what engineers call a verification gate. OpenAI does not have one. Anthropic does not have one. Google does not have one. The Yale team built one, published the code, and measured what it does.
